AI Summary
-
Requires unemployment claimants to complete no fewer than five work search actions per week when claiming benefits, with the administrator defining valid work search actions by regulation
-
Adds failure to appear for a previously scheduled job interview and failure to participate in an approved training program as grounds for disqualification from unemployment benefits
-
Requires claimants to accept suitable work within the time frame specified in the job offer or face disqualification
-
Mandates the administrator create an online/electronic form for employers to report suspected work search violations and inform employers annually about reporting importance
-
Effective date: December 31, 2025
